Fertilization amount of corn

The nutrient uptake of corn per 100kg of corn kernels is absorbed by the soil, climate (rain, temperature, light) varieties, yield and other factors. As the increase in production has decreased, the exception is nitrogen. Experiments show that the ratio of N, P, and K absorbed by corn (N: P2O5: K2O) averages 1:0.48:0.79.

Physiological characteristics of corn required for fertilizer


During the growth and development of corn, it is necessary to continuously absorb various nutrients from the soil and synthesize organic substances that supply growth and development. During the whole growth period, the most nutrient elements absorbed by corn are N, P, K, S, Ca, and Mg. The nutrients absorbed in corn's lifetime are N most, K is less, and P is less. Since most of the elements in the soil can meet the needs of corn growth, the fertilization in production is mainly the application of N, P and K fertilizers.

The absorption of N, P and K in the whole growth period of maize is basically a trend of "less-more-less". That is, the seedling stage grows slowly, the plant is small, and the nutrient absorption is small; from the jointing to the flowering stage, the growth is rapid, and the nutrient is absorbed; in the late growth stage, the growth is slowed down and the nutrient absorption is small.

According to the research of Shandong Academy of Agricultural Sciences, the period from jointing to tasseling is the peak period of corn nutrient. At this stage, although the dry matter accumulation is only about 1/3, the cumulative absorption of N element accounts for 50% of the total growth period. P accounted for 48% and K accounted for 71%. During this period of growth, both vegetative and reproductive growth, the nutrient supply during this period, is extremely important for corn production.


China's corn planting is extremely extensive. Due to regional, climatic, soil conditions, water conditions, and sputum, there are significant differences among different regions. Therefore, the fertilization methods and fertilization techniques are different in different regions, and their respective fertilization modes are formed. .

Corn fertilization technology
1. Fertilization principle The principle of fertilization of corn should be: base fertilizer should be applied as much as possible, organic fertilizer and chemical fertilizer should be matched; N, P, K fertilizer and trace elements should be combined; base fertilizer, seed fertilizer and top dressing should be combined to make various fertilizers Balanced supply, only the balance of various nutrients, can play the benefits of each nutrient.

2. Fertilization method

(1) base fertilizer
The base fertilizer is extremely important for the growth and development of corn. The direct effect is beneficial to the robust growth of the early growth stage, and in fact has an important impact on the whole life of the corn, especially the nutrient supply of P and K in the corn. Therefore, in the general area, the nitrogen fertilizer in the base fertilizer can account for more than 50% of the total fertilization amount, and the P and K fertilizers are basically 100% applied as the base fertilizer.

In the northeast spring corn area, because of the sowing in the dry land without irrigation conditions, the corn often has a bad soil and cannot be traced when it needs to be topdressed. Therefore, in the northeast corn area, it is now generally applied once in the form of base fertilizer and topdressing.

In the summer maize area of ​​the Huang-Huai-Hai Plain, after the wheat harvest, the cultivated land is generally not used, and the corn-based fertilizer can not be applied. This often results in insufficient supply of phosphorus in corn, which affects the increase in production. After the test, the phosphate fertilizer can be appropriately added in the previous season wheat.

(2) Top dressing
Considering the requirements of corn for fertilizer, corn should be applied three times with top dressing, namely joint fertilizer, ear fertilizer and grain fertilizer. Corn topdressing is generally applied with chemical nitrogen fertilizer, mainly urea and ammonium bicarbonate. Topdressing should be done in deep application. In dry land, whether it is good or bad, it is necessary to use acupoints or strips.
